What if I can't find the pairing code?
If the pairing code is not displayed on your device or on-screen
in CSR Harmony, then many devices ship with a default pairing
code. This may be 0000 or 1234.
Refer to the documentation that came with your device.
Why did connection fail?
You may be unable to connect to your device for a number of
reasons, these include:
You did not respond to the request to enter a pairing code
within the 30 second time interval
An incorrect pairing code was entered
The local (CSR Harmony) or remote Bluetooth device was
switched off or unavailable
You cancelled the pairing operation
Ensure the device is turned on, is in range, has Bluetooth
enabled and is discoverable, then see Adding a Bluetooth
device to connect to it.
I can't hear audio on my stereo headset
You may be unable to hear audio on your headset because:
The headset is not connected
The headset is not selected as the audio device for play back
